The first thing you're going to need to do is associate metadata with the docker file you're planning on using to build your container. If you've already got a container(s), you can still use foxy to start, stop, or display the docker inspect report, but you won't be able to view the port resolution tables or have one-click access to available web services.

Foxy metadata is associated with the *LABEL* tag in a dockerfile. Below is an example of what this might look like for a containerized cloudera cdh stack:

### known issues
* the search feature is currently in development and is non-functional.
* foxy needs to be packaged properly so that the user doesn't have to manually install cherrypy.
* if you create metadata for a given port number then don't expose that port, foxy freaks out. so, yeah, don't do that.
* I'm pretty sure you can only associate one tag with a port.
* None of this has been unit tested.
* Currently you need to start foxy from within the ./foxy directory -- this is probably an artifact of my not having packaged this correctly yet...
* when you click on the 'help' button nothing happens.
* anyone anal about PEP-8 will probably freak out (rightfully) about the state of the code. if this is you, maybe don't do that. or better yet, make a pull request.
